Lbp Am Sa Has $112.10 Million Position in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. (NYSE:TSM)

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ing logo with Computer and Technology background

Lbp Am Sa lowered its holdings in shares of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. (NYSE:TSM - Free Report) by 5.1% during the first qu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 675,316 shares of the semiconductor company's stock after selling 36,644 shares during the period.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ing comprises 1.7% of Lbp Am Sa's portfolio, making the stock its 11th largest holding. Lbp Am Sa's holdings in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ing were worth $112,102,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Trading Down 0.6%

Shares of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ing stock opened at $227.80 on Wednesday.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. has a 12-month low of $133.57 and a 12-month high of $237.58. The business's 50 day moving average is $202.98 and its 200-day moving average is $191.89. The company has a quick ratio of 2.18, a current ratio of 2.39 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.22. The stock has a market cap of $1.18 trillion, a P/E ratio of 29.28, a P/E/G ratio of 1.19 and a beta of 1.29.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ing (NYSE:TSM -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, April 17th. The semiconductor company reported $2.12 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$2.03 by $0.09.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ing had a return on equity of 31.43% and a net margin of 41.67%. The business had revenue of $25.82 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$834.10 billion. Equities research analysts predict that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. will post 9.2 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Profile

(Free Report)

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Limited, together with its subsidiaries, manufactures, packages, tests, and sells integrated circuits and other semiconductor devices in Taiwan, China,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, Japan, the United States, and internationally. It provides a range of wafer fabrication processes, including processes to manufacture complementary metal- oxide-semiconductor (CMOS) logic, mixed-signal, radio frequency, embedded memory, bipolar CMOS mixed-signal, and others.
